Stopped for lunch at Doc Watson’s in Oakland, NJ and had a great experience. Service was friendly and quick. We started with the chili, which came with crispy tortilla chips and hit the spot. We ordered two spicy chicken sandwiches. Both had a breaded chicken breast, pepper jack cheese, frizzled onions, and chipotle mayo. One came with bacon and maple fries, the other with regular fries. Everything was hot, flavorful, and satisfying. Solid lunch stop with good food and great service.
